Vitamin B12 is also called cobalamin, it is a very important nutrient for our body. It is important for the formation of red blood cells, DNA synthesisis and proper functioning of the nervous system. Its deficiency is considered dangerous, as it can give rise to many serious health problems.

Different vitamins and minerals are required to run our body smoothly, and one of them is the most important vitamin B12. This vitamin is found mainly in animal products, so there is a high risk of its deficiency in vegetarians and vegan people. But it is not limited to food and drink; Many times the body is not able to offer it properly.

Why is Vitamin B12 deficiency dangerous?

There are many reasons to consider vitamin B12 deficiency as dangerous, as it affects many important functions of the body.

  • Nerve damage: The protective layer that surrounds vitamin B12 nerves is essential for the construction and maintenance of myelin. Its deficiency can damage myelin, causing nerve damage.
  • symptoms: Numbness in the hands and feet, tingling irritation, weakness, muscle cramps, difficulty walking, balance of balance (attachment), and not being able to guess the condition of body parts correctly.
  • hazard: If it is not treated for a long time, this nerve damage can be irreversible.

Megaloblastic anemia

Vitamin B12 is important for the production of red blood cells. Due to its lack, large, unusual and immature red blood cells begin to form in the body, which are not able to take oxygen efficiently.

  • Symptoms: Excessive fatigue, weakness, breathlessness, dizziness, yellow skin or jaundice, rapid heartbeat.
  • Danger: Severe anemia can put extra pressure on the heart, which increases the risk of heart disease or heart rate.

Cognitive and mental problems

Vitamin B12 is important for brain health and function. Its deficiency can cause a hindrance to the production of neurotransmitters.

  • Symptoms: Symptoms such as weakening of memory, difficulty thinking (mental fog), confusion, decrease in concentration, irritability, depression, and symptoms such as dementia and paranoiya can also be seen.
  • Danger: If remained untreated for a long time, then this cognitive decline can also be irreversible.

Digestive problems

  • Vitamin B12 deficiency can lead to gastrointestinal problems such as diarrhea, constipation, abdominal pain, loss of appetite, nausea and vomiting.
  • hazard: These problems can give rise to other nutritional shortcomings and affect the quality of life.
  • Other physical symptoms: Swelling and pain in the tongue (glossitis), mouth blisters, hair fall, dryness of the skin, and nails can also be a sign of its deficiency.

Who is more in danger?

  • Vegetarian and Vegan: Since vitamin B12 is mainly found in meat, fish, eggs and dairy products. Therefore, there is a high risk of deficiency in those who do not consume these diets.
  • Elderly person: With aging, the body’s ability to absorb vitamin B12 decreases.
  • People with digestive disorders: There may be a problem of absorption in Crohn’s disease, celiac disease, or gastric bypass surgery.
  • Some medicines taking people: Some drugs, such as proton pump inhibitors (acidity medicines) and metformin (diabetes medicines), may affect the arbzabation of vitamin B12.
  • Parnician anemia: It is an autoimmune disease in which the body is unable to make an intrinsic factor.

These are rescue and treatment

Vitamin B12 deficiency can be diagnosed with blood tests. It is usually treated through vitamin B12 supplements. It is also important to include foods rich in B12 in the diet such as milk, yogurt, cheese, eggs, fish, meat and fortified grains.
Vitamin B12 deficiency is a serious condition, which should not be taken lightly. It is important to identify its symptoms and to treat it on time, so that damage can be avoided.
